Author: phd
Date: 2005-06-14 13:04:22 +0000 (Tue, 14 Jun 2005)
New Revision: 816
Modified:
trunk/SQLObject/sqlobject/sqlbuilder.py
Log:
Fixed a very subtle bug - self.items is being appended.
Modified: trunk/SQLObject/sqlobject/sqlbuilder.py
===================================================================
--- trunk/SQLObject/sqlobject/sqlbuilder.py 2005-06-14 11:13:08 UTC (rev 815)
+++ trunk/SQLObject/sqlobject/sqlbuilder.py 2005-06-14 13:04:22 UTC (rev 816)
@@ -445,7 +445,7 @@
select = "SELECT %s" % ", ".join([sqlrepr(v, db) for v in self.items])
tables = {}
- things = self.items
+ things = self.items[:]
if self.whereClause is not NoDefault:
things.append(self.whereClause)
for thing in things:
|